According to CNN Health, road rage incidents have surged 500% in the United States since 2016, and maybe you've been part of that statistic, even if it was just flipping someone off on 95 or 5th Avenue.

Some cities are worse than others, and it shouldn't be too surprising that larger cities with more traffic, like New York, reign supreme on this list.

According to the Angel Reyes and Associates website, New York didn't top the list but did make the top 10.

Aggressive or violent motorists range from verbal insults to physical violence. Road rage isn't always caused by another person, either. It can simply build up because of weather, traffic, construction, or anxiety level at the time, because of things going on in life.

Here are your top 20 road rage cities, with New York just ahead of Boston, nearly rounding out the top 10.

  1. Houston, Texas
  2. Chicago, Illinois
  3. Los Angeles, California
  4. Nashville, Tennessee
  5. Miami, Florida
  6. Philadelphia, Pennsylvania
  7. Atlanta, Georgia
  8. Detroit, Michigan
  9. New York, New York
  10. Boston, Massachusetts
  11. Seattle, Washington
  12. Aurora, Colorado
  13. Austin, Texas
  14. Dallas, Texas
  15. San Francisco, California
  16. Tacoma, Washington
  17. Charlotte, North Carolina
  18. Washington, D.C.
  19. Arlington, Texas
  20. Phoenix, Arizona
